    There are free stickers of cute avocado characters by the door. Place your order and you will be given a number to place on your table. They will bring the food out to you. The Flavored water is complimentary and very refreshing; cucumber water and the other is pineapple and strawberry water. Me and my friend shared the sampler and the avocado vegan chorizo wrap. The sampler had 2 of everything. Avocado fries were crispy outside and were very soft inside. Avocado deviled eggs we chose to have bacon on it, which we got lots of it and were gone in two bites. Avocado eggrolls were filled with avocado and so good. The avocado samosa were good but couldn't taste the avocado. The potatoe and peas made it very filling though. The sampler came with aioli and sweet and sour sauce. I liked the aioli sauce more, but most I had without the sauce. Next we shared the avocado vegan chorizo wrap. It was just like the photo on their website, very big and stuffed. It was sweeter and it came with a few greens in the side. So I had to tame the sweetness with the greens. There are to go containers by the flavored water/drinks area. There is no garbage can around since they will clean the table for you. Very clean inside and staff are very friendly. There is also a small merch section near the bathrooms. Please note, (for those that watch their calorie intake) on the website and menu next to the prices are the calories from fat and not the Total calories. The total calories can be found on their website a link that has the breakdown of all the ingredients for all the items on their menu.
